Parent Forum

Hello from Meridian's Parent Forum!

The Parent Forum has been set up as another way of communicating with parents/carers and to share views and find out more about how Meridian Primary School and Nursery works.  It is another way in which the school is able to find out about the views of parents and for the school to share successes, what current improvements are being worked on and to answer questions parents might have about education at Meridian. The Parent Forum is open to all parents and carers across the school and the Headteacher attends every meeting to hear your views.  It is a great way for Meridian parents/carers and the school to work in partnership with one another to support our children. 


We want to help parents/carers have a better understanding of how Meridian school operates and how the school is developing and improving. We hope to help parents/carers support their children's learning and help parents understand what is happening in school to make sure our children are getting the best education. It is not the place for parents to raise individual issues or specific complaints or concerns - the school has a complaints procedure for this and your first step should be to talk to your child's class teacher.
